As IBM announced to end support for Faspex 4 on 30th September 2023, all users are encouraged to migrate to Faspex 5. The technical webinar outlined the key differences, new features and migration requirements, ensuring a smooth transition for all.

Faspex 5 introduces a cutting-edge web interface and experience, elevating both the user journey and security to unprecedented levels. Its fortified security system is a significant enhancement, providing users peace of mind when sending large files as easily as an email. 

Harnessing the power of containerisation, this state-of-the-art tool has been completely redesigned as a suite of Docker containers. This modern approach allows for streamlined deployment whether standalone, within an on-premises data centre, or in the cloud, while also simplifying the processes of upgrades and updates. 

This forward-thinking platform is fully compatible with any MariaDB compliant database, which is fully backed by major cloud providers, assuring high availability and reinforcing the robust security framework. 

Faspex 5 also prepares for the future, providing seamless integration capabilities for the forthcoming Files and Console applications. This ensures that the tool is always primed for growth, promising a consistent and adaptable experience for users.
